Description
The property opens into a distinctive entrance hall that immediately gives a sense of the character found throughout the house. A staircase rises to the first floor, while attractive internal doors lead into the two reception rooms and kitchen.
The bay fronted living room is a particularly impressive space, with high ceilings, deep skirting boards and ornate plasterwork adding plenty of period detail. Despite its size, it still feels comfortable and cosy, with ample room for large sofas and additional furniture.
Across the hallway is the dining room, which has exposed wood flooring, an original fitted cupboard and windows to both the front and rear. The modern kitchen has a good range of wall and base units, integrated appliances and a central breakfast bar. Two large windows provide plenty of natural light, while there is also useful storage beneath the stairs.
A door leads into the large utility room, which provides further storage, plumbing for a washing machine and space for a dryer, alongside the modern boiler. External doors provide access to both the front and rear gardens.
On the first floor, the principal bedroom is an excellent size and has with windows to two elevations. The second bedroom is another comfortable double, again with windows to the front and rear. The spacious house bathroom has a large corner bath, separate shower and built in storage.
Two further double bedrooms are found on the second floor, both with recently replaced Velux windows and useful eaves storage, along with a separate shower room.
Outside, the mature front garden provides a good degree of privacy, while the larger than average rear garden has a choice of flagged seating areas, a central lawn and established borders. There is also a stone built outhouse and off road parking for two cars, accessed via King Edward Street.
With Sutton Park seconds away and local schools within easy walking distance, this is a substantial family home in a location where properties of this type rarely become available.
